Critiqual Inquiry, University of Chicago Press
Jerome Bruner (1991)
The Narrative Construction of Reality
Bruner's foundational argument that narrative is not decoration but a primary mode of thought — the way humans make meaning, not just communicate it. Theoretical grounding for all narrative strategy work.
Harvard Business Review
Gary A. Williams, Robert B. Miller (2002)
Change the Way You Persuade
Classic HBR framework identifying five decision-making styles and how to tailor persuasion approaches to each. Widely used in advocacy and communications strategy for stakeholder mapping.
The Glamour of Grammar
Roy Peter Clark (2006)
Climb Up and Down the Ladder of Abstraction
A craft-focused chapter on moving between the concrete and the abstract in writing and storytelling. The ladder of abstraction is one of the most useful tools for making complex issues feel tangible.
Narrative, Ohio State University Press
Suzanne Keen (2006)
A theory of narrative empathy
Why does a story move you when a statistic doesn't? Suzanne Keen's foundational theory maps the actual mechanics, bounded, ambassadorial, and broadcast strategies of narrative empathy that explain why fiction reaches people facts can't.
Academy of Management Learning & Education
Marshall Ganz, Julia Lee Cunningham, Inbal Ben Ezer, Alaina Segura (2020)
Crafting Public Narrative Crafting Public Narrative to Enable Collective Action
Ganz's influential framework for building public narrative through Story of Self, Story of Us, and Story of Now. The theoretical backbone of much leadership and civic organising training globally.
Environmental Research Letters, IOP Science
Kris De Meyer et al. (2021)
Transforming the Stories We Tell About Climate Change: From 'Issue' to 'Action'
Argues that climate communications has been stuck in a problem-issue frame and proposes a shift to an action frame rooted in agency. Offers a practical narrative architecture for campaigners.
Frameworks Institute
Lindsey Conklin, Andrew Volmert (2021)
How Do Other Fields Think About Narrative? Lessons for Narrative Change Practitioners
What can climate communicators learn from advertising, screenwriting, and psychoanalysis? FrameWorks went outside its usual circle of experts and came back with eight transferable lessons for narrative change.
Stay Grounded
Stay Grounded, New Weather Institute, with regional partner contributions (2022)
Common Destination: Reframing Aviation to Ensure a Safe Landing
A full reframing toolkit for aviation advocacy, developed by Stay Grounded. Demonstrates how to shift from technical-regulatory arguments to values-based frames — a replicable methodology for other sectors.
Social Media + Society, SAGE
Waqas Ejaz, Adil Najam (2023)
The Global South and Climate Coverage: From News Taker to News Maker
Examines the shift in global climate media from a Global North-dominated agenda to increasing Global South production and leadership. Documents what is changing — and what structural barriers remain.
Journal of Agricultural Education
Parisa Paymard, Gary Ellis, Gary Briers (2025)
Storytelling and Narrative Transportation as a Catalyst for Self-Efficacy and Action in the Face of Climate Change
Tests whether narrative transportation — being drawn into a story — increases self-efficacy and intention to act on climate. Finds that story-based communication outperforms factual information for motivating behaviour.
Thomson Foundation
Sylivester Domasa, Evalilian Massawe, Hassan Mhelela, Catherine Mackie, Ernest Sungura (2026)
Climate Crisis Toolkit for Media in Tanzania
A toolkit "simple enough to act on, not just read". Built for Tanzanian media with input from journalists, scientists, and legal experts, it pairs storytelling with practical guidance and a reminder: most of its intended audience hasn't even heard the term "climate change."
